| Taite Music Prize - Rules and Judging Criteria |
|
Nomination Process Members of IMNZ may nominate up to five albums released in the previous calendar year (Jan to Dec 2011). Non-IMNZ member record labels may nominate up to five albums released in the previous calendar year (Jan to Dec 2011) at a cost of $25+gst per nomination. If self-nominating, the record label must also make available two gratis copies of the relevant CD/Vinyl to IMNZ. If the album was only released digitally, nominations must be accompanied by 2 CD burns at no cost to IMNZ. Please send to: IMNZ, PO BOX68-890, Newton, Auckland. Please be aware that IMNZ will make these available to the judges via streaming for the Prize judging process of the nominated albums. One copy of the nominated album will be retained by IMNZ for archival purposes. It is important for the success of this event and the future of the prize that nominated artists are available to attend the TMP event in Auckland on April 20th 2012. If self-nominating, the record label must also acknowledge and confirm that they have notified the relevant artist. Ineligible entries will be notified to the nominating IMNZ member immediately after the IMNZ board meeting in January 2012. All entries will be accepted via the application form on the IMNZ website (www.indies.co.nz); however final entry is at the absolute discretion of the IMNZ board. IMNZ must receive all entries by 5pm on Monday the 23rd January 2012. Finalist Process If your nominated album is selected as a finalist, it will enter Phase Two of the judging process, and IMNZ will contact the releasing record label to supply copies of physical stock of the album for that secondary process, at cost price to IMNZ. This will allow the ten person judging panel to assess the album in its entirety including the music, packaging and album artwork. The physical copies of the finalist albums will be retained by the judging panel as renumeration for their individual efforts.
